A multi-tool that you can wear on your wrist is a pretty good idea. This tread bracelet is crafted of high strength, corrosion resistant 17-4 stainless steel links that include 2 to 3 functional tools each, making a total of 25 usable features like box wrenches and screwdrivers available at a moment’s notice.
And it’s adjustable to 1/4” via slotted fasteners (remove or add the links/tools you need), so it will to fit on all wrist sizes. Even the clasp is functional with a bottle opener and #2 square drive.
Other link tools include a cutting hook, hex drives, screwdrivers, box wrenches, and a carbide glass breaker. What about an option to attach a watch face? It is stated as comfortable to wear. Will it be TSA approved when launched this summer by Leatherman Tool Group?
